These are the kinds of circuits many folks use for their portable space heaters, and that’s the beginning of the problem. Power strips are not designed or equipped to safely handle the energy load and extra electrical current flow that a space heater generates. Here’s some more explanation: Extension cords usually can’t handle high current. Circuit breakers, sometimes called fuses, limit your power usage to a level that the wiring system can safely handle.
